Here's Video Of Messi's Pretty Goal From Today's Barca-Arsenal Match
FC Barcelona defeated Arsenal 3-1 this evening in Camp Nou. Lionel Messi scored twice — first on this pretty self-assist over the goalkeeper's head just before halftime, and second on a penalty kick in the 71st minute of play. With a 4-3 lead over Arsenal on aggregate, Barcelona will now go on to the quarterfinals of the UEFA Champions League.
Arsenal played one man down after Robin van Persie was thrown out in the second half after a controversial second yellow card for "delaying time." He was called offside on a breakaway, and kicked the ball away after the whistle, which he claimed not to have heard over the din of nearly 100,000 drunk, screaming Spaniards. Likely story!:
